Understanding PEG Feeding: What is PEG Feeding?

Definition and Overview

Percutaneous Endoscopic Gastrostomy (PEG) feeding involves positioning a tube directly into the stomach to provide nutrition to individuals who can not eat by mouth. This method is commonly used for people with neurological disorders, head and neck cancers cells, or extreme swallowing difficulties.

Common Signs for PEG Feeding

PEG feeding may be suggested for a variety of problems:

    Neurological disorders (e.g., stroke) Cancer influencing the throat or esophagus Severe malnutrition Chronic diseases impacting swallowing

Specialized Focus: Peg Training for Nurses

Role of Registered nurses in Enteral Nourishment Support

Nurses play an essential function in handling individuals obtaining enteral nutrition by means of PEG tubes. They are responsible for guaranteeing proper tube positioning, checking complications, and informing clients about their treatment plan.

The Significance of Peg Feeding Support Employees' Role

Understanding the Role of Support Workers in Enteral Nutrition

Support workers are usually on the front lines when it involves helping patients with day-to-day requirements associated with their enteral nutrition regimen.

Responsibilities Might Include:

    Tube maintenance Administering feedings Monitoring patient feedbacks

Proper training guarantees they can execute these jobs effectively.
